    MDW Associates is seeking a Project Manager III to support the Office of the Under Secretary of Defense for Research & Engineering in Arlington, Virginia. The Manager will provide Joint Defense Manufacturing Technology Panel (JDMTP) support for Task Order (TO) execution.

    The Project Manager will perform the following job functions:

    • Identify and integrate joint requirements, conduct joint program planning, and implement joint strategies according to a common DoD ManTech Program strategic vision.
    • Ensure coordination and collaboration of project activities across the DoD.
    • Coordinate with the JDMTP Chair and OSD ManTech leadership to plan bi-annual (twice per year) JDMTP All Hands Meetings.
    • Serve as the OSD Executive Secretary for the JDMTP by coordinating topics, developing materials, arranging schedules, and supporting periodic JDMTP meetings at the principal level (monthly and ad hoc as required), sub-panel technical working group level (monthly and ad hoc as required), and action officer level (monthly and ad hoc as required).
    • Schedule and facilitate standing Action Officers meetings (monthly and ad hoc as required).
    • Issue data calls, collect, collate, and catalog information from JDMTP Principals, and Service and Agency ManTech organizations.
    • Assist with creating DoD ManTech Gold Book and annual success stories brochure.
    • Implement process improvement and information sharing across the DoD ManTech Program.
    • Assist conference organizers with planning the annual Defense Manufacturing Conference (DMC) and annual Defense Manufacturing Technology Achievement Awards. Support DMC Planning Meetings (bi-weekly and then weekly as the DMC date approaches).
    • Support JDMTP member participation in the annual DoD ManTech Program Congressional Staffer Day and annual DoD ManTech Program Pentagon Outreach Day.

    Required Experience:

    • Superior planning, organizational, and communication (written and oral) skills with the ability to tailor efforts and products to the proper level of meeting participants (e.g., working, management, and executive levels).
    • Skill and experience leading team scenarios, driving consensus and conducting collective activities.
    • Experience working with Senior leaders.

    Education Requirement/Required Years of Experience:

    • Bachelor's degree in a technical field from an accredited college or university is required with five (5) years of relevant professional experience.

    Clearance Requirement(s):

    • Candidates for this position must have an Active US Secret Security Clearance
